Keep in mind, it is a gender thing too. Men will lose faster than women every time. It may stink, it's true. So, don't beat yourself up over this. Besides, your only competition is with yourself. That's usually your biggest adversary. I think your on the right track with exercise. Even just small amounts do so much, including decreasing appetite. Pick something fun so you stick with it. Look back to your childhood or whenever you did something more active and do that activity. You'll be moving and having fun and probably stick with it because you like it. Just don't overdo it to the point you don't want to go back tomorrow. I used to stop just before I got tired so I still had a desire for it the next day. That was a trick I used in the beginning...it worked...silly psychology. You can do it and your worth it !!!
